Aikido Kenkyukai's Sydney City Dojo is conveniently located a short distance from Central Railway Station, inside Victoria Park. Aikido classes are held at the Victoria Park Swimming Pool complex, situated inside the park, opposite the University of Sydney and Broadway Shopping Centre (corner of Parramatta & City Roads).

Sydney City Dojo is a 15-20 minute walk from Central Station and the University of Technology (UTS), or a 5-10 minute bus ride (routes 412, 413, 422, 423, 426, 428, 435, 436, 437, 438, L38, 440, 461 and 483 all stop at Victoria Park). Free parking is also available inside the park and in nearby side streets if you choose to drive.

Aikido Sydney - Aikido Kenkyukai Sydney's City Centre Dojo chief instructor, Berin Mackenzie pictured at a recent seminar in Chile, South AmericaAikido classes Sydney Morning and evening classes are led by Berin Mackenzie, an Australian instructor who lived and studied intensively in Japan under the great Takeda Yoshinobu Shihan, an 8th dan Aikido master.

We welcome men and women of any age interested in dynamic, non-violent martial training and exploration. No experience is necessary and practitioners of other Aikido styles and martial disciplines are also very welcome!
